John Ira Rollins 1890–1955 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 26 Jan 1890

Birth Location: Hartford, Cocke, Tennessee, USA

Death Date: 13 Mar 1955

Death Location: Newport, Cocke, Tennessee, USA

Father: James Rollins

Mother: Martha Ball

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

In 1890, John Ira Rollins entered the world in Hartford, Cocke, Tennessee, USA, born to James V Rollins And Martha A Ball. John Ira Rollins passed away in 1955 in Newport, Cocke, Tennessee, USA.
